Pros & Cons

Auto-generated from official data — head-to-head differences and gaps vs the national average.

Clearwater, FL
Pros
Homes cost $171k less ($287,900 vs $458,600)
54% less violent crime than Salt Lake City
Milder winters — January highs near 71°F vs 40°F
Smaller class sizes — 15.9:1 student-teacher ratio
Cons
Median income trails Salt Lake City by $12,999/yr
Higher unemployment (4.7% vs 3.6%)
Higher rents — median is $1,389/mo
Cost of living runs 6% higher than Salt Lake City
Salt Lake City, UT
Pros
Households earn $12,999 more per year on average
Stronger job market — unemployment is 1.1 pts lower (3.6%)
More college-educated — 50.2% hold a bachelor's or higher
Rent averages $135/mo less ($1,254 vs $1,389)
Commutes run 3 min shorter each way
6% cheaper overall cost of living than Clearwater
Cons
Pricier housing — median home is $458,600
Violent crime (864.2/100k) is above the U.S. average of 380
Property crime (5200.0/100k) runs high vs the U.S. average
Snowy winters — about 49" of snow per year

Full Data Comparison

Metric Clearwater, FL Salt Lake City, UT
💰 Cost of Living
Cost of Living Index National avg = 100 · lower = cheaper 103.4⚠ High 97.7 ✓ Cheaper
Median Home Value $287,900 ✓ Lower $458,600⚠ High
Median Monthly Rent $1,389⚠ High $1,254 ✓ Lower
📈 Income & Economy
Median Household Income $59,358 $72,357 ✓ Higher
Unemployment Rate 4.7%⚠ High 3.6% ✓ Lower
Avg Commute Minutes each way 22.8 min 19.7 min ✓ Shorter
Work From Home % 16.4% ✓ Higher 15.9%
🔒 Safety
Crime Index 100 = national avg · lower = safer · 60% violent / 40% property 99 ✓ Safer 236⚠ High
Violent Crime Index 100 = national avg · lower = safer 104⚠ High ✓ Safer 227⚠ High
Property Crime Index 100 = national avg · lower = safer 90 ✓ Safer 248⚠ High
🎓 Education
School Quality 100 = national avg · grad rate, staffing & attainment B (101) B+ (105) ✓ Better
Student-Teacher Ratio Lower = smaller classes 15.9:1 ✓ Smaller 18.2:1
Bachelor's Degree or Higher 31.9% 50.2% ✓ Higher
High School or Higher 90.8% 91.2% ✓ Higher
School District Name only — no quality rating available PINELLAS Salt Lake District
🌤 Weather
Avg High — January 70.6°F ✓ Warmer 39.7°F
Avg High — July 90.3°F 91.4°F ✓ Warmer
Annual Precipitation 56.1" 17.7" ✓ Drier
Annual Snowfall 0.0" ✓ Less 49.0"
👥 Demographics
Population 116,984 201,269 ✓ Larger
Median Age 46.0 ✓ Older 32.5
Homeownership Rate 58.8% ✓ Higher 47.0%
Under 18 17.6% 18.0% ✓ More
Over 65 23.5% ✓ More 11.6%
